Nearly Departed...zombie adventure
 
I'm assuming this is an amateur game, but maybe they have bigger plans? Anyway, it's being made with LASSIE, and there is a single screenshot. See it here:

http://www.gmacwill.com/lassie/games.shtml

Direct link to pic: http://www.gmacwill.com/lassie/image...g_departed.jpg

Quote:

Title: Nearly Departed

Overview: You emerge from a grave, apparently a zombie with amnesia, and have to solve the mystery of your demise while resisting your craving for BRAINS!

Hello, all!

I didn't think there'd be any threads started about my project anywhere yet. I'm thrilled to see there's interest this early.

Yes, it is an amateur game. I'm currently just working on it in my spare time as a hobby. No release plans have been set just yet, though I just about have the first two rooms done.

I put up a quick website where I'll post images and updates. There are just two screenshots, and the site is pretty barebones. Maybe I'll make the site better at some point, but right now any extra time I have is going toward the game itself.

Anyway, this is my first point & click game (and my first computer game in over ten years) so I hope when it's done everyone will find it worthwhile.

JohnGreenArt 02-18-2006 11:05 PM

Hamham Chan: I do like some horror movies, zombie films specifically, and there may be a sly reference to a few here and there in the final game. There will be sly references to lot of things, actually.

usman:

1) The demo will only run in 800 x 600 but there will be a full screen option for the final game.

2) The dialog is slow just because there's no actual voices in place. The final game will have full voices, and once there is the text will pass at the speed the recorded voice does. As it is now, you can click the mouse to skip through dialog.

I'm glad you like the game, thanks for the compliments. As for the date of release, it's really too soon to estimate right now.
